Astrocytes regulate synaptogenesis, stabilize synaptic … Witryna16 kwi 2024 · The dynamic structure of the extracellular matrix includes two distinct entities, the basement membranes (BM) and the interstitial matrix (IM) that are intimately interconnected. The BM is located beneath the epithelial and endothelial cells, the IM in the lamina propria, submucosa, and in muscular and serosa layers. Proteoglycans are proteins that have been substituted by glycosaminoglycans (GAGs), which are linear polysaccharides made up of a repeating disaccharide, usually an acetylated amino … Witryna21 maj 2024 · The Extracellular Matrix of Elastic Cartilage. The ECM of elastic cartilage contains elastin, fibrillin, glycoproteins, collagen types II, IX, X and XI, and (predominantly) the proteoglycan Aggrecan. These …
